    9Wayne1921

    Well Performed and Directed

    Frankly, Terminus is smarter than those leaving the exaggerated negative reviews here. That might explain the "booooring" reactions to this very nicely turned, intelligent plot line that places character development at the center of an interesting take on how an alien intelligence is responsible for a hinted at 21st century version of Adam and Eve.

    Jai Koutrae, Kendra Appleton, and Todd Lasance turn out terrific, understated performances; the script is compelling and held my interest from the opening moments. The Brian Cachia score is first rate and sustained the almost nourish mood throughout. (It's sometimes forgotten how important the music is to driving the plot line). To echo another reviewer's comment, Mark Furmie's direction is indeed, "motivated and inspired."

    If you're expecting the typical dumbed-down, mind-numbing tripe that passes for sci-fi née fantasy these days (think auto-bots and Marvel comics), you'll be disappointed. But if, for example, Ex Machina and Under the Skin appealed to you, and you're looking for low-key, intelligent, well performed and directed story-telling, you'll enjoy Terminus.
    5phlipsidecreative

    A Solid Mid-Range SciFi Flick

    This movie is nowhere near as bad as some reviews claim. At the bottom line you find a solid concept - the world stands at the edge of the apocalypse. A war in the Middle East threatens to boil over at any moment. But an artifact/lifeform from beyond Earth may be the answer humanity needs. Is it weapon or cure?

    I will grant you that much of the story won't surprise you, but it's pretty well done in that comfortable storytelling zone. The acting is fair to good (sadly, the main character is the least gifted actor's role). This is pure average-guy-fighting-the-evil-government stuff. There are some dumb moments (an operation on a living person that uses a cast saw? Really?) but there's enough here to carry you to the end.

    Great science fiction? No. Worth your time? Absolutely.
    7siderite

    Atmospheric and gloomy, but a nice original piece of sci-fi

    You need to be in the mood to watch this. The basis of the plot is revealed early on and from there it's all about what happens around that central point. It has to do a lot with how people think and feel and why they do what they do and how it affects the world entire. It is a slow story, gloomy, antiwar and anti rampant Americanism.

    I have to say that the negative reaction of some of the other commenters is not warranted. It was an average movie, but one of those that has enough good things to offset some minor bad things, like some sluggishness of the script and some mediocre acting. I think the worst sin the producers of this film committed is that they made a very intriguing trailer that far outshined the movie itself. Almost all high end scenes are in the trailer, that is. Big Hollywood films do that, so why no them, eh? Because you get people upset, as many comments on this site show.

    Bottom line: I wish the film would have been more worked on. As such, it is a gem that is still in the mud. I feel that with another edit of the material it could really shine.

    • Goofs
      Even though the story allegedly takes place in the United States, many references to Australia are seen in the film, throwing the story off.

      Chrysler 300C driven by the government agents is right-hand-drive. As the agent exited the left side of Chrysler, the dashboard is briefly visible to have no steering wheel on the left side.

      The green-white pictogram for emergency exit sign is visible in the hospital. The American equivalent is red EXIT.

      The doorknobs are positioned close to the shoulder height: typical feature in Australia and New Zealand but never in the United States.

      The telephone at repair garage is Australian and never been available in the US.
